Education Opportunities in Bridge Creek

Education is a crucial consideration for families with young children, and Bridge Creek does not disappoint. The town accommodates several daycare centers and preschools, ideal for early childhood education. Schools such as Bridge Creek Early Childhood Center cater to the youngest residents. Parents also benefit from the close proximity to educational resources in Oklahoma City, offering a blend of suburban and urban schooling experiences.

Pros:

  • Personalized attention in smaller educational settings.
  • Proximity to Oklahoma City expands educational choices.

Cons:

  • Limited number of advanced educational facilities directly in the town.
  • Potential need for commuting to the city for diverse programs.

Healthcare Services: An Essential Consideration

Healthcare is another priority for families with babies. Bridge Creek provides essential pediatric care services, ensuring that your little ones receive the best in medical attention. For more specialized medical care, families might need to travel to nearby Norman or Oklahoma City, where top-tier hospitals like the Children's Hospital at OU Health are located.

Pros:

  • Proximity to high-quality pediatric hospitals in nearby cities.
  • Essential services conveniently available within the town.

Cons:

  • Travel required for specialized or emergency care.
  • Limited local healthcare facilities.

Outdoor Spaces: Fun Under the Sun

Outdoor spaces are abundant in Bridge Creek, featuring numerous parks and playgrounds. The Bridge Creek Public Park offers a great place for family gatherings and playdates, with well-maintained playground equipment and ample picnic areas. The nearby Lake Thunderbird State Park also provides additional recreational space for family outings.

Pros:

  • Multiple parks and outdoor spaces for family activities.
  • Safe and scenic parks conducive to family picnics and baby-friendly play.

Cons:

  • Limited indoor family entertainment during bad weather.
